Christopher Douglas Stewart (born July 15, 1960) is an American politician, author, and businessman who served as the U.S. representative for Utah's 2nd congressional district from 2013 until his resignation in 2023.

May 31, 2023 · SALT LAKE CITY ( ABC4) – Rep. Chris Stewart, 62, officially resigned from his seat in the U.S. House of Representatives on Wednesday after six terms in office. In a statement released on social media, Stewart said it was one of the great honors of his life to serve the people of Utah in Congress.
